Local cycling insights:

When cycling in Cape Town, don't miss the chance to explore the Winelands region on two wheels. The vineyard-lined roads and picture-perfect landscapes make for a memorable ride. Stop for a wine tasting or picnic along the way to truly experience the beauty of the area.

For a more urban cycling experience, explore the colorful suburbs of Bo-Kaap and Woodstock. These vibrant neighborhoods are filled with street art, trendy cafes, and local boutiques waiting to be discovered on a bike.

For beginners, the Sea Point Promenade and Green Point Urban Park offer flat, easy paths with stunning views of the ocean. These routes are perfect for a leisurely ride.
Cycling in Cape Town can be safe as long as you follow basic safety precautions. Stick to designated cycling paths, wear a helmet, and be cautious when sharing the road with vehicles.
Yes, there are several mountain biking trails in and around Cape Town, including the Tokai Forest, Jonkershoek Nature Reserve, and Tygerberg Mountain Bike Trails. These trails offer a mix of terrains for all skill levels.

The best time for cycling in Cape Town is during the spring and autumn months when the weather is mild and pleasant. Avoid cycling in the heat of summer or the rainy winter season for the most enjoyable experience.
